    [Misc] B 350 shows "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per"

    HI there,

    Can anybody help me with this problem. I've got a machine in the field, with only 50K copies on. Suddenly the machine give a message, out of both paper cassettes "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per" when you make copies, run test mode from tech rep, and even when you press test button on Printer control board at the back. I have replaced:

    Paper trays
    Paper feed units
    Paper lift-up section (Whole unit at the back of tray)
    Power supply
    PWB A (Printer Board)
    Firmware

    Could any body assist me in this regard, I would appreciate it.

    Re: B 350 shows "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per"

    Does this usually happen after a few sheets have ran thru? I would start with the registration clutch and if that doesnt fix it u have to replace the clutch that is located behind trays 1&2. U have to remove both trays and feed assys. Then that assy can come out. It has a belt and some gears on it. About 6 screws and clutch connector(can be a pain, unplug it by going thru the side door and not from bypass area!

          Re: B 350 shows "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per"

          I had a similar issue: the machine would get 4-5 pages into a print job, then pop up with the same message. All the sensors looked good in I/O checks, and the trays/feed assemblies appeared to be in good shape. Tried the old trick of padding the rear side of the paper tray to push the drop-down assembly further...nothing. The problem continued even after rebuilding the paper feed unit, cleaning the clutches and buffing up the shafts. I ended up installing a new feed assembly, rather than waste time on further diagnosis. Unfortunately I ended up taking the shotgun approach, but replacing the feed assembly seems to have done the trick.

                Re: B 350 shows "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per"

                Hi Guys,

                Thanks for all the info. Just a bit of feedback regarding the problem. I eventually got it sorted. Don unfortunaly the senson wasn't the problem, but we'll make a plan to have that beer another time.

                We've replaced the whole registration section in the right hand door, and it fixed it. It would appear to me that it was detecting the wrong size paper at registration and didn't correspont to the tray size.

                    Re: B 350 shows "Pull out the selected tray, then load paper"

                    I would start with the registration clutch
                    Sorry, but I ran through this post so fast that I thought you had already done what smellshot said. This is the first thing the Kon-Min knowledgebase says to do. When that didn't work for me once, I remembered another tech had same experience. It usually is the reg. clutch, but we each have one instance of the vert. sensor doing same "replace paper" symptom.
                    BTW, you can get CRC electronics cleaner from Ace Hardware and spray the clutch out. Seems to work great for two guys I got that from. One has done it for years on Sharps and one on these KM's. I sprayed one yesterday for jamming at reg. clutch and ran over 100 ok. We'll see. Glad I've saved the 5 or so clutches we've replaced in past year. Gonna flush them out and recycle them.
